The MSAD 11 Art Extravaganza will be held on Wednesday, May 11 from 3 p.m. to 6 p.m. at Gardiner Area High School. It will feature art created by students in art classes. In addition, book art, video production films, and music performed by high school students will be featured.
With support from Gardiner Thrives to promote healthy choices and well-being, Little Chair Printing will be demonstrating screen printing powered by a bicycle. Prints and other keepsakes will be for sale.
Upstream, a nonprofit dedicated to fish passage, will be showing their newly released video, Keystone: Voices for the Little Fish featuring students and staff from the high school. They will also be creating a mural in the hallway offering guests an opportunity to make wishes for fishes.
Face painting, button making, and book art stations will provide opportunities to create art. This event is free and open to the public. All are welcome to attend and celebrate the arts!
